Abstract:
What is described is a tire pressure sensor for use in a wheel of aircraft landing gear. The tire pressure sensor includes a position sensor configured to detect a movement of the wheel and generate a wheel movement signal based on the movement. The tire pressure sensor also includes a processor coupled to the position sensor. The processor is configured to receive the wheel movement signal, determine a wheel rotational speed of the wheel based on the wheel movement signal and generate a wheel rotational speed signal based on the wheel rotational speed.
Abstract:
A handheld interrogation device includes a controller configured to generate a power signal. The controller is also configured to determine tire pressure data based on a signal received from a tire pressure sensor. The handheld interrogation device also includes a primary coil coupled to the handheld interrogation device and configured to transmit the power signal to a sensor coil of the tire pressure sensor and to receive a data signal from the sensor coil, via inductive coupling, in response to the primary coil being within a predetermined distance of the sensor coil.

Abstract:
A wheel monitoring system comprising a wheel, a bearing mechanically coupled to the wheel, an axle mechanically coupled to the bearing, and a wheel speed transducer (WST) disposed in the axle. The WST may be configured to detect vibrations. A method of monitoring a bearing is also provided and may comprise measuring a vibration of the bearing, comparing the vibration of the bearing to a predetermined vibration, and estimating a remaining useful life of the bearing.

Abstract:
A system for measuring tire pressure on an aircraft includes a wheel with a tire pressure. A tire pressure sensor on the wheel may be configured to output an electronic measurement of the tire pressure. A transmission device may be electrically coupled to the first tire pressure sensor and configured to transmit the first electronic measurement. A hubcap may be on the first wheel with a transmission device mounted to the hubcap.
Abstract:
A connector assembly includes a first side connector and a second side connector. The first side connector includes a first protective housing, a first inductor including a first end face, and a first physical connector element. The second side connector includes a second protective housing, a second inductor including a second face, and a second physical connector element. The second physical connector element is engaged with the first physical connector element and physically connects the first side connector to the second side connector such that the first end face and the second end face are adjacent. The first inductor and the second inductor are axially spaced apart. The first inductor and the second inductor form an inductive telemetry connection between the first side connector and the second side connector.
